Game 379. 1:00 PM PST/4:00 PM EST. Both Utah and Oklahoma State are expected to contend for the Big 12 Title. So, this matchup, both squads Conference openers, could have some serious ramifications down the road. They both enter this contest ranked as the Utes are 12th in the nation, and the Cowboys are 14th. Both enter this game a perfect, 3-0. Utah has faced and beaten a little tougher competition in Baylor and Utah State, while Oklahoma State had a tough time in their only step up in class against Arkansas a few weeks back. This is truly their toughest contest thus far this regular season. Both teams possess two of the most experienced and talented quarterbacks in college football, as Cam Rising and Alan Bowman lead the offenses. Both are expected to have very good games here. However, there is no question Oklahoma State pass defense is a bit more lax, to say the least. As a matter of fact, through the three games this season against San Diego State, Arkansas, and Tulsa, they rank 128th against the pass. That would be bad enough. But they also rank 92nd against the rush. No question Utah's defense is tougher. In a game in which we expect a lot of scoring, it will come down to which defense steps up and plays better. Without a doubt, that belongs to the visitor here. Giving the Utes points is a mistake. Take Utah. Thank you.
